Where exactly do I find Asset Studio in the Google Ads interface?
Open your Google Ads account, go to the left navigation and expand Assets, then click Asset Studio. You can also land on it from inside a video campaign build when the ad screen asks for a YouTube video URL and offers to create one for you. Your YouTube channel needs to be linked to the Google Ads account first, otherwise the generated video has nowhere to publish.
Do videos created in Asset Studio have to be uploaded to YouTube?
Yes. Every YouTube video ad has to reference a video hosted on YouTube, so Asset Studio pushes the finished file to your linked channel, usually as an unlisted upload. Unlisted means it will not show on your channel page or in public search but it can still be served as an ad. If the link between Google Ads and the channel breaks, the ad will stop being approvable.
Why is Performance Planner not the right answer here?
Performance Planner is a forecasting tool. It tells you what conversions or reach you can expect at different budget and bid levels across the next quarter. It has nothing to do with creating an ad, so it does not solve a production problem. This is a common trap because the question mentions a campaign, and people associate campaign planning with Performance Planner.
What are the practical limits of building video ads from static images?
Template based videos work well for product shots, offers and simple brand messages, but they will not carry a story or an emotional hook the way filmed footage does. Use them to get a campaign live, then test proper creative once you have performance data. Keep text short, place the logo and call to action where they survive vertical crops, and build separate versions for 16:9, 1:1 and 9:16 so your ads run cleanly across YouTube Shorts, in-feed and in-stream placements.
